Dancing Girls

Run From Fire

Dancing girls, and school children fled from their bed- rooms and classrooms into the streets yesterday when a fro broke out on the roof top of a building in Wanchal District.

The fire broke out on the roof top of No. 104, Lockhart · Road. Old furniture and pieces of wood heaped near a chimney was set ablaze by sparks shooting out of the chimney.

When the fire alarm was sounded frantic students of the Kiu Kwong School which occu- ples part of the building and the inmates of a cabaret dormitory, rushed out to the streets. They thought ike building was on fire.

The dancing girls were sleep- ing when the alarm was sounded. They covered themselves with blankets and overcoats and rush-

On the 4th of March inst., Mr. Leo d'Almada e Castro wil deliver a lecture entitled "Some notes on the Portuguese in Hong Kong." This lecture will

at

take place at the Club Lusitano. Ice House Street No. 18, 6.00 p.m.
